Why does my floor feel dry when the restoration company says it's still wet?

Surface 'dryness' is a psychrometric illusion. In the Port Canaveral District's humid climate, moisture migrates into porous substructures, creating a vapor pressure differential. The IICRC S500 standard of care requires drying to a specific equilibrium moisture content, not a tactile feel. We verify this by measuring the moisture in the air itself, using psychrometric readings to achieve a target of 40 Grains Per Pound (GPP) at 70°F, which is the dry standard for this environment.

How quickly does mold become a problem after a water leak?

The mold growth window is 24–48 hours in Cape Canaveral's climate. Post-2026 insurance policy language increasingly assigns liability for mold-related damages to the property owner if documented, IICRC-compliant mitigation does not begin within this window. Professional remediation initiated within the standard of care window is critical to prevent a secondary, often non-covered, loss.

My insurer called my flood water 'Category 3.' What does that mean for my claim?

In Zone AE, Category 3 typically refers to black water from storm surge or saltwater intrusion, which is grossly contaminated and poses significant health risks. This classification triggers specific, extensive S500 remediation protocols. Proactively, Florida insurers now offer an 8-12% premium credit for IoT leak sensors (e.g., Moen Flo). These devices provide immediate intrusion alerts, potentially mitigating the severity of a claim and demonstrating risk reduction to your carrier.
